vs.
Hah! The battle of the magazine titans rolls on... Right now we have:

Hearst:
Cosmopolitan/Marie Claire
Condé Nast:
Glamour

Hearst:
Harper's BAZAAR
Condé Nast:
Vogue

Hearst:
Esquire
Condé Nast:
GQ

Hearst:
House Beautiful
Condé Nast:
House and Garden

Hearst:
Teen Cosmo
Condé Nast:
Teen Vogue

Hearst:
Redbook
Condé Nast:
Self

*theabove chart is purely my own speculation. feel free to correct me if I'm wrong.

So what's next? A new women's shopping magazine called Shop etc. Sounds familiar? Yes, Hearst is putting out this magazine, I guess to compete directly with Conde's Lucky, which is first of its type and have won good reviews and adage magazine of the year.

Also, men, don't feel left out, because soon at your local newstand you'll have plenty of new "shopping" magazines to choose from: Condé Nast will be launching Cargo, a male version of Lucky, and it's sibling company Fairchild will launch Vitals, also a men's shopping magazine. I'm sure Hearst would not be far behind, especially if Shop etc. becomes a real success.
